Kiwi Slides After Rate Cut (Video)

  • The New Zealand dollar has broken through major support during the trading session on Wednesday as the 0.5850 level has been broken.
  • Now we’re threading the crucial 0.58 level.
  • If we can break down below that level, it’s likely that we could go much lower, perhaps sending this market down to the 0.56 level.
  • Short-term rallies will continue to be selling opportunities at the first signs of exhaustion from what I can see.

Cutting Rates and the Reaction

And with that being the case, I think we have a situation where you will be paying attention to the fact that New Zealand just cut rates and are likely to continue doing so. After all, New Zealand is highly sensitive to Asia. And as long as that trade war between the United States and China continues, it is going to have a peripheral effect. It’s worth noting that both the New Zealand dollar and the Australian dollar have underperformed against the U.S. dollar in comparison to some other currencies such as the Euro or the British pound. And as a result, I think you have to assume that if the U.S. dollar starts to strengthen overall, these currencies are going to be some of the biggest losers.

NZ trade swings back into deficit despite broad export gains

New Zealand’s trade balance flipped back into deficit in July, with imports outpacing exports despite solid overseas demand. Goods exports climbed 10% yoy to NZD 6.7 billion, but imports rose 2.6% yoy to NZD 7.3 billion, leaving a monthly deficit of NZD -578 million compared with expectation of NZD 70 million surplus. Rupee rises 14 paise to 86.93 against US dollar in early trade

The rupee appreciated 14 paise to 86.93 against the US dollar in early trade on Thursday, on positive domestic equities and a rise in risk-on sentiments. Forex traders said the rupee is trading with a positive bias on a rise in risk appetite in the global markets amid hopes of peace between Russia and Ukraine.

At the interbank foreign exchange, the rupee opened at 87.04, then touched an early high of 86.93, registering a gain of 14 paise over its previous close. File
